"Permission denied" errors on /run/teamd/team0.conf when starting or restarting NetworkManager
Issue
- When trying to start or restart NetworkManager with a teamed interface, the restart fails
- The logs for the start or restart show the following:
teamd: Failed to get absolute path of "/run/teamd/team0.conf": Permission denied
systemd: teamd@team0.service: main process exited, code=exited, status=1/FAILURE
systemd: Failed to start Team Daemon for device team0.
systemd: Unit teamd@team0.service entered failed state.
network: Bringing up interface team0: Job for teamd@team0.service failed. See 'systemctl status teamd@team0.service' and 'journalctl -xn' for details.
network: [FAILED]
Environment
- Red Hat Enterprise Linux 7
- NetworkManager with a teamed interface set up
